Course Outcomes

Read Old Gothic Script

Students will be able to read at a basic level, old gothic-script Norwegian, Danish, Swedish and Finnish documents, from the 1600s on up.

Date Conversion

Students will be able to use Scandinavian conversion calendars, to convert Latin feast dates to regular Julian calendar dates.

Read Scandinavian Documents

Students will be able to read, at a basic level for content from Scandinavian printed documents. of the 1700s and 1800s.
